Schiavo Parents' Options Dwindle as U.S Judge Set to Rule Again

http://www.bloomberg.com/apps/news?pid=10000103&sid=aLgUQBhz6dmE&refer=us

snippet from above...

By yesterday evening the Schindlers were in U.S. District Court in Tampa, where Judge James Whittemore had earlier this week rejected a request to order reattachment of the surgical hose. Whittemore, after both sides argued for three hours that Terri Schiavo's constitutional rights had been severely violated, said he wouldn't leave the courthouse until he had made a decision.

``It is my intention to work until I have completed a ruling on this,'' said Whittemore as the hearing concluded at about 9:45 p.m. ``I'll be here as long as necessary.''
